Trudy SPIIRAN
RUS  ENG    JOURNALS   PEOPLE   ORGANISATIONS   CONFERENCES   SEMINARS   VIDEO LIBRARY   PACKAGE AMSBIB  
General information
Latest issue
Archive

Search papers
Search references

RSS
Latest issue
Current issues
Archive issues
What is RSS



Informatics and Automation:
Year:
Volume:
Issue:
Page:
Find






Personal entry:
Login:
Password:
Save password
Enter
Forgotten password?
Register


Trudy SPIIRAN, 2014, Issue 34, Pages 218–231 (Mi trspy742)  

Software Development: Software Design Using UML Diagrams and Petri Nets for Example Automated Process Control System of Pumping Station

A. A. Voevoda, A. V. Markov, D. O. Romannikov

Novosibirsk State Technical University
References:
Abstract: Methods and techniques of software design as one of the important stages of software development are described in the paper. The method of software design with using of UML with Petri nets for analyzing of dynamic properties of set UML diagrams is described. Authors offer improved method of using of integration of UML diagrams and Petri nets. The offered method was used for designing of software of automated process control system (APCS) of pumping station: designing of use case, class, object diagrams and sequences diagram that was transformed to Petri net with help of formal rules. Some incorrect states that occurred after pumps enabling/disabling by operator were identified by analysis of Petri net. Reachability tree of the system was gotten by analysis of the Petri net (the value of the tree is about 106 of nodes). Testing of offered system was showed on example of APCS of pump station.
Keywords: UML Diagrams, Petri Nets, Class Diagram, Object Diagram, Activity Diagram, State Space Algorithm, Pumping Station.
Document Type: Article
UDC: 004.4'22
Language: Russian


Citation: A. A. Voevoda, A. V. Markov, D. O. Romannikov, “Software Development: Software Design Using UML Diagrams and Petri Nets for Example Automated Process Control System of Pumping Station”, Tr. SPIIRAN, 34 (2014), 218–231
Linking options:
  • https://www.mathnet.ru/eng/trspy742
  • https://www.mathnet.ru/eng/trspy/v34/p218
  • Citing articles in Google Scholar: Russian citations, English citations
    Related articles in Google Scholar: Russian articles, English articles
    Informatics and Automation
    Statistics & downloads:
    Abstract page:392
    Full-text PDF :349
    References:45
     
      Contact us:
     Terms of Use  Registration to the website  Logotypes © Steklov Mathematical Institute RAS, 2024